    ^Gulten free crackers are great!

    Some of my favourites:
    1.Natural pop-corn-low fat, yummy-and crunchy to boot!
    2. Hummus (with either gluten free crackers or veg' sticks).
    3. Home made salsa with organic corn chips: finely diced tomatoes, spanish onion, cucumber, green pepper/capsicum, coriander, chilli/jalapenos (give or take), garlic, olive oil, lime juice, tabasco sauce, cracked black pepper.
    4. Home made Guacamole with organic corn chips: cubed avocado, finely diced or crushed garlic, finely diced spanish onion, sea salt & cracked black pepper & drizzled with olive oil and lime juice.
    5. Avocado with sea salt (give or take), cracked pepper and a squirt of tabasco sauce is a GREAT alternative to dips!
    6. Snack on a handful of berries or fruit, om nom nom nom!
    7. Salads!
    8.Yoghurt/or Frozen yoghurt (while it may still have some sugar, it is a bit healthier than ice cream).
    9. Not a food, but anyways lol-green or herbal tea-so healthy and low-cal, calming and even warming in the winter time. Or, sparkling mineral water with fresh lime-great alternative to soda!
    10. Home made soup-yum!
    11. Rice or corn cakes with smeared goats cheese/or low fat cream cheese topped with cucumber or tomato slices and cracked pepper (or anything yummy you have on hand). Or Chilly Philly lol.
    12. Flavoured canned tuna (with or with out crackers).

    Last night I made baked kale chips with sea salt and nutritional yeast, which gives a great cheese-like, umami taste. It's such an easy, delicious, and inexpensive snack. I also enjoy full fat yogurt with melted raw honey and fruit. The yogurt is so filling that I almost never finish a recommended serving size, and it's actually helped me lose some weight.
